COURSE INFORMATION

We are pleased to invite you to register for a comprehensivecourse in hepatology to be held at the UCH Education Centre(www.ucheducationcentre.org) from the 29th to 30th April 2014.The aim of the course is to provide a strong foundation in hepatology,from which future gastroenterologists and allied health careprofessionals can use as a springboard to becoming specialists withinthe field.

investigation and management of patients with acute and chronicliver disease

• Topics mapped to the (JRCPTB) curriculum in hepatology withlearning outcomes that can be uploaded to the JRCPTBe-portfolio

• A deeper understanding of the basic science of liver disease
